Many years ago, a fellow student in my year came back from a trip to Hong Kong with a very expensive SLR that he had bought there. He had just walked through the green channel with it.
He continued to take it on trips overseas, always walking through the green channel.
The camera had been through the green channel four or five times before he was stopped. Customs knew from the serial numbers that the camera had been bought in Hong Kong and asked for the receipts for the camera and customs duty.
They confiscated the camera and he had to pay duty on the original cost, plus VAT, plus I think a penalty charge to get it back..
